Carefully unpack the analyzer, ensuring all accessories (waste container, reagent tubing) are present. Position the analyzer, keeping it away from direct sunlight and electromagnetic interference.

Turn on the analyzer. The instrument will automatically perform a self-test check of the fluidic system, motor, and detection components.
